Transaction 75fa3b06b8e4a3d5c2d4b9a1cd5a08cb18502026a4abb1e9a8de7f5485f4b695

28 Input
2 Outputs
  • 75fa3b06b8e4a3d5c2d4b9a1cd5a08cb18502026a4abb1e9a8de7f5485f4b695:0
  • value  409023771
    address  36yo33XDCkqbDF6VKcWpvH5RR21a3g57F6
  • 75fa3b06b8e4a3d5c2d4b9a1cd5a08cb18502026a4abb1e9a8de7f5485f4b695:1
  • value  452481418
    address  3EGLrEKmnrqmDG88UuB8FihGSdEKU9eiPi